Output dd06ac14b100607dc40ba61d86f8e241f71ac994990c2d523adcef422046a5dc:0

value
158335
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9bf35a3d591b47c926a149505a401b954fbee6f5 OP_EQUAL
address
3FucBhsYQJcvTQZVsTJSid1wymCzpo3eb2
transaction
dd06ac14b100607dc40ba61d86f8e241f71ac994990c2d523adcef422046a5dc
confirmations
132794
spent
true